What does HALO treat?

  • Fine lines and wrinkles
  • Sun damage and dyschromia (discoloration)
  • Scar revision
  • Pigmented lesions
  • Enlarged pores

These common skin concerns affect more than the skin on your face, so it’s only appropriate that the HALO laser treats other areas as well. Patients can receive the treatment on their face, neck, chest, arms, hands, and legs.

Who is a good candidate for HALO?

Something unique about this treatment is that it can be performed on any skin tone. Oftentimes lasers are limited to fairer skin types, but this one can be customized and used safely on olive to darker tones. How does it work?

HALO is the world’s only Hybrid Fractional Laser that delivers a non-ablative and ablative wavelength at the same time. Combining two wavelengths addresses many levels of skin concerns in ONE efficient treatment.

  • Ablative wavelengths target and treat the skin for surface-level conditions such as textural issues and pore size. By creating small thermal injuries in your skin, the ablative wavelengths kickstart the production of new, healthy skin for visible results in a short period of time. Ablative = top layer of skin (epidermis).
  • Non-ablative wavelengths target damage existing in the deeper layers of skin, also known as the dermis. These wavelengths are adjustable to address deeper sun damage, remove dermal pigmentary issues, and stimulate new collagen production. Non-ablative = deep layer of skin (dermis).
  • Together, these wavelengths provide both short-term results and long-term benefits to a wide variety of patients.

    Aftercare

    Despite treatment being customizable to each individual patient’s needs, the recovery experience and post-treatment care remains the same. Patients experience redness and swelling like a sunburn sensation, and tightness of skin. A bronzing, sandpaper-like texture begins at day 2-3 as the MENDS (microscopic epidermal necrotic debris) make their way to the surface of the skin and fall off by days 4-5 (depending on depth and density of the treatment).

    Our providers recommend using a gentle cleanser and moisturizer to protect and comfort the treated area. Patients can choose to do a single HALO treatment or opt for a series of treatments depending on depth, your skin health, and lifestyle needs.
